What is the best area to stay in Whitsundays?
Daydream Island is the premier choice for travelers looking to experience the breathtaking beauty of the Whitsundays. This idyllic island, formerly known as West Molle Island, is renowned for its stunning landscapes and luxurious amenities. With its soft, white coral beaches and crystal-clear waters, Daydream Island provides a great backdrop for relaxation and adventure. The Daydream Island Living Reef, a coral lagoon enveloping the resort, offers guests an opportunity to connect with marine life through interactive exhibits and guided experiences led by resident marine biologists.

For couples seeking a romantic escape, Daydream Island is a dream come true. Picture yourselves lounging in a hammock with a tropical drink in hand, or wandering hand-in-hand along the peaceful trails of the island's rainforest. The tranquil atmosphere and stunning vistas create an intimate setting, great for creating lasting memories together.

Families will also find Daydream Island to be an ideal destination. The resort features a range of activities suitable for all ages, from tennis courts and a children's playground to guided walks and fitness classes. The open-air cinema and trivia nights add a fun twist for family bonding after a day of exploration. Moreover, the Daydream Island Rejuvenation Day Spa offers relaxation options that cater to every family member, ensuring a well-rounded experience.

When is the best time to go to Whitsundays?
The most popular time to visit the Whitsundays is during the dry season from June to August, with July being particularly favored. During these months, temperatures typically range from the mid-60s to the low 70s Fahrenheit, providing a comfortable climate that is superb for outdoor adventures and beach activities.

As peak tourist season kicks in during July, you can expect a lively atmosphere with plenty of visitors eager to experience the stunning beauty of the islands. This is an ideal time for those who enjoy sailing, snorkeling, and soaking up the sun on the pristine beaches. The warm, sunny days and gentle breezes create a picturesque setting for exploring the Great Barrier Reef, renowned for its vibrant coral and marine life.

For travelers seeking a more tranquil experience, consider visiting during May or September. These months still offer pleasant weather and slightly fewer crowds, allowing you to enjoy the breathtaking scenery and local attractions with a bit more peace. You'll find that accommodations may also be more budget-friendly at this time, while still providing the attentive service and quality experiences you value.
